NYC ultra-luxury market surges amid global unrest

A potent mix of global instability and financial anxiety is supercharging demand for New York City’s priciest homes — even as broader luxury segments grapple with stubborn inventory shortages. HousingWire Data shows pending sales in the ultra-luxury single-family market — defined by a $4.3 million median price — surged 200% in the latest weekly period.

What Washington state agents are seeing with new ‘millionaires tax’

Washington state is entering a new policy era with its “millionaires tax” — targeting high-income earners who shape the luxury real estate market. The law imposes a 9.9% tax on annual income above $1 million, with implementation expected in 2028 pending legal challenges. First fully rebuilt Palisades home testing post-fire demand

Fourteen months after California’s Palisades wildfires destroyed nearly 5,900 homes, the first fully rebuilt residence has come to market, offering the clearest pricing test yet for post-fire demand. The newly built contemporary home — listed at just under $7.5 million — comes after the original was just one month from completion when it was destroyed.
